
South Korean cryptocurrency exchange Bithumb mistakenly transferred over 620,000 bitcoins, worth around 40 to 44 billion won, to 695 users during a promotional event. The exchange restricted trading and withdrawals within 35 minutes and recovered 99.7% of the bitcoins. Bithumb apologized for the error, which briefly caused a 17% drop in bitcoin prices on its platform. The company stated the incident was unrelated to hacking and will cover any losses with its own assets.
